Kinds Of Glazing Services
Comprehending the numerous kinds of residential glazing services is essential for property owners who want to make informed decisions. Below are some typical glazing options offered:
Type of GlazingDescriptionSingle GlazingIncludes one pane of glass, typically less energy-efficient.Double GlazingFeatures two panes with an air space, improving insulation and reducing sound.[Triple Glazing Replacement](https://md.swk-web.com/ZK3J_a1iSxqPR8-IJEBkRQ/) GlazingIncludes a third pane, taking full advantage of insulation and energy performance.Low-E GlassCoated glass that reflects infrared light, keeping homes cooler in summertime and warmer in winter season.Laminated GlassGlass with a plastic interlayer, boosting security and minimizing noise.Tempered GlassHeat-treated glass that is stronger and shatters into little, blunt pieces.3. Benefits of Residential Glazing
Purchasing professional glazing services can bring numerous benefits that boost both the performance and visual appeal of a home. Here are some essential benefits:

Energy Efficiency: Upgrading to double or triple glazing can considerably reduce heat loss, leading to lower energy bills.

Noise Reduction: Higher-quality glazing can also lessen unwanted outdoors sound, developing a quieter indoor environment.

Increased Safety: Laminated and tempered glass options provide added security versus damages and invasions.

Improved Aesthetics: A well-chosen glazing service can boost the general design and appeal of a home.

Natural Light: Large glass setups permit for more natural light, promoting a favorable environment within the home.

UV Protection: Low-E glass can filter out harmful UV rays, securing furniture and flooring coverings from fading.
